Moreover, authentic multilingual foreign trade website systems require cultural adaptation—including currency, time zones, payment methods, and privacy policies—beyond language switching. While some platforms offer multilingual templates, their lack of deep market understanding creates fragmented user experiences. Businesses should prioritize platforms with localization strategy capabilities rather than superficial text translation.

Google confirms each 1-second page load delay increases bounce rates by 30%. Thus, responsive website platforms require robust infrastructure. Leaders use global CDNs with AWS/Aliyun deployments, keeping latency under 100ms. One case study showed 40% faster landing pages, consistent 90+ PageSpeed scores, and 35% organic traffic growth post-CDN. SSL certificates, DDoS protection, and encrypted storage further ensure business continuity.
Mobile adaptation is equally vital. With over 60% cross-border searches coming from mobiles, platforms must provide truly responsive templates. Some "responsive" claims merely scale content, causing misaligned buttons or broken forms. Businesses should test multi-device compatibility and monitor LCP, FID, and CLS Core Web Vitals.
Foreign trade needs vary by sector: manufacturers highlight product specs and certifications; eCommerce focuses on checkout flows; B2B services emphasize branding. Generic tools struggle with these nuances—industry-specialized platforms excel.
